From: Yaakov Selkowitz <yselkowitz@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x> Various schemes exist to allow parallel installations of multiple major versions of Qt (4.x with the previous 3.x and/or the upcoming 5.x). QtCore.pc includes a moc_location variable which should be a more reliable way to find moc.
